Vertex Agility
Senior .NET Developer (C#)
Vertex AgilityPoland21 hours ago
ContractRemote FriendlyInformation Technology

Job Opportunity: Senior .NET Developer (C#)

Location: Cracow - hybrid model (2 days per week from the office)

Type of contract: B2B

English: B2+


Role Overview

We’re looking for an experienced Senior .NET Developer to join an international engineering team building a modern trading and pricing platform for structured financial products.

The role focuses on backend development in C#, designing and maintaining scalable, high-performance services used by global business teams.

This is a great opportunity for someone who enjoys creating reliable systems from the ground up and modernizing existing internal tools into stable, cloud-ready solutions.


Responsibilities

  • Design, build, and maintain backend services and APIs using C# / .NET.
  • Participate in the full software development lifecycle from requirements analysis and design to deployment and production support.
  • Modernize and migrate existing internal applications (e.g., Excel/VBA tools) into .NET-based systems.
  • Work with relational and NoSQL databases to store, retrieve, and manage data efficiently.
  • Ensure code quality through testing, automation, and continuous integration.
  • Collaborate with global engineering and business teams to align technical solutions with functional requirements.
  • Take ownership of the backend architecture, focusing on performance, scalability, and reliability.


Requirements

  • Strong, hands-on experience in C# development and solid understanding of object-oriented programming.
  • Familiarity with modern engineering practices - including unit testing, CI/CD, and DevOps principles.
  • Experience with relational databases (Oracle, PostgreSQL) or NoSQL databases (MongoDB).
  • Understanding of event-driven architecture and/or RESTful API design.
  • Strong sense of ownership, analytical mindset, and ability to work in a distributed global environment.
  • Excellent communication skills in English (spoken and written).
  • Nice to have
  • Familiarity with cloud platforms such as Google Cloud (GCP) or Azure.
  • Experience in financial systems, risk management tools, or trading applications.


What we offer:

  • B2B contract.
  • Private medical care, life insurance, and access to Multisport card.
  • Stable, long-term projects with full-time employment.


If you’re a C# developer looking to work on technically challenging projects with global impact and a modern tech stack, do not hesitate to apply!

Key Skills

Ranked by relevance